Job Description

Job Description Lead end-to-end power assessments across utility, MV/LV distribution, UPS, generators, and rack delivery Evaluate AC/DC and 800VDC readiness, including safety risks, operational impact, and workforce implications Translate assessments into standardized architectures and recommendations (no custom engineering) Build phased roadmaps aligning infrastructure upgrades with AI-scale growth, safety gating, and workforce transformation Define power-train adoption strategies with clear safety and execution milestones Act as the technical authority on power infrastructure in client engagements Mentor internal consultants and elevate technical rigor across delivery Contribute to and improve Vertiv's consulting frameworks, tools, and IP Engage with senior stakeholders/executives to communicate findings and shape decisions We are a company committed to creating diverse and inclusive environments where people can bring their full, authentic selves to work every day. Skills and Requirements 10+ years in data center power systems, mission-critical infrastructure, or consulting Deep expertise across facility power (utility → rack) Experience with high-density / AI data center environments Exposure to DC systems, AC/DC transitions, or high-voltage environments (ex: 800VDC) Strong understanding of electrical safety, operational risk, and reliability Comfortable working within standardized/structured consulting frameworks Proven ability to own client relationships and present to senior leadership Experience tying technical upgrades to workforce training & operational change Background in risk assessment + safety-driven design/operations Prior experience in consulting or advisory roles vs pure engineering/design Ability to balance technical depth with business/executive communication
